Mutation in the seed storage protein kafirin creates a high-value food trait in sorghum.
Nature communications - 1 Jan 2013
Wu Yongrui, Yuan Lingling, Guo Xiaomei, Holding David R, Messing Joachim
Abstract excerpt
Sustainable food production for the earth's fast-growing population is a major challenge for breeding new high-yielding crops, but enhancing the nutritional quality of staple crops can potentially offset limitations associated with yield increases. Sorghum has immense value as a staple food item...
